“When Books Disappear, Stories Die.” Book censorship has surged dramatically across the United States, and this week the numbers became impossible to ignore. According to PEN America’s new report, 6,870 books were banned during the 2024–2025 school year — across 23 states and 87 public-school districts.This isn’t a small issue.This is a literary crisis.
